Patent number: 11943539Abstract: An environmental capture system (ECS) captures image data and depth information in a 360-degree scene. The captured image data and depth information can be used to generate a 360-degree scene. The ECS comprises a frame, a drive train mounted to the frame, and an image capture device coupled to the drive train to capture, while pointed in a first direction, a plurality of images at different exposures in a first field of view (FOV) of the 360-degree scene. The ECS further comprises a depth information capture device coupled to the drive train. The depth information capture device and the image capture device are rotated by the drive train about a first, substantially vertical, axis from the first direction to a second direction. The depth information capture device, while being rotated from the first direction to the second direction, captures depth information for a first portion of the 360-degree scene.Type: GrantFiled: May 13, 2022Date of Patent: March 26, 2024Assignee: Matterport, Inc.Inventors: David Alan Gausebeck, Kirk Stromberg, Louis D. Marzano, David Proctor, Naoto Sakakibara, Simeon Trieu, Kevin Kane, Simon Wynn

Patent number: 10244418Abstract: Systems and methods for quality of experience measurement and wireless network recommendation and/or switching are disclosed. In some embodiments, a method comprises connecting to a cellular data network, measuring a signal strength value of a Wi-Fi data network within range of the digital device, calculating an overall Wi-Fi score based on the measured signal strength value of the Wi-Fi data network, measuring a signal strength value of the cellular data network, calculating an available bandwidth of the cellular data network, calculating an overall cellular data network score based on the measured signal strength value of the cellular data network and the calculated available bandwidth of the cellular data network, comparing the overall Wi-Fi score and the overall cellular data network score, and switching from the cellular data network to the Wi-Fi data network based on the comparison of the first bandwidth score to the bandwidth threshold value.Type: GrantFiled: August 31, 2015Date of Patent: March 26, 2019Assignee: Devicescape Software, Inc.Inventors: John Gordon, Simon Wynn, Justin Reigle, Cedar Milazzo

Patent number: 9913303Abstract: Systems and methods for network curation are disclosed. In some embodiments, a method comprises scanning, by a mobile device, an area to identify a network device for accessing a network, receiving, by the mobile device, a network identifier associated with the network device, providing a curation indicator request to a curation server, the curation indicator request comprising the network identifier, receiving a curation indicator from the curation server, the curation indicator being retrieved, based on the network identifier, from a database of a plurality of curation indicators, the curation indicator associated with a likelihood of intent to publicly share the network by the network device, comparing the curation indicator to an access setting, the access setting indicating acceptability of network access based on the likelihood of intent to publicly share the network by the network device, and accessing the network via the network device based on the comparison.Type: GrantFiled: August 30, 2016Date of Patent: March 6, 2018Assignee: Devicescape Software, Inc.Inventors: Simon Wynn, John Gordon

Publication number: 20170085575Abstract: Systems and methods for determining location over a network are disclosed. In some embodiments, a method comprises scanning, by a digital device, an area for one or more wireless networks, receiving one or more BSSIDs associated with the one or more wireless networks, generating a location request in a DNS protocol formatted message, the location request comprising the one or more BSSIDs, providing the location request, receiving a location response based on the location request, and retrieving at least one location identifier from the location response.Type: ApplicationFiled: April 25, 2016Publication date: March 23, 2017Inventors: Simon Wynn, John Gordon, David Whedon Kimdon

Patent number: 9531835Abstract: Exemplary systems and methods for sharing a personal network of a first user are provided. The exemplary method comprises receiving credentials for the personal network which are used to generate a network profile. When an indication to share the personal network is received, one or more user devices of a second user are queued to receive the network profile. The network profile is then provided to the one or more user devices to provision the one or more user devices for accessing the personal network.Type: GrantFiled: June 27, 2007Date of Patent: December 27, 2016Assignee: DEVICESCAPE SOFTWARE, INC.Inventors: Simon Wynn, David G. Fraser

Publication number: 20160345191Abstract: Systems and methods for quality of experience measurement and wireless network recommendation are disclosed. In some embodiments, a method comprises connecting to a non-cellular wireless data network, the digital device capable of communicating over a cellular network, transmitting a plurality of pings to a QoE system accessible over the non-cellular wireless data network, receiving a set of ping responses from the QoE system in response to the plurality of pings, calculating a QoE score based on the set of ping responses, and determining whether to maintain connectivity with the non-cellular wireless data network based on the QoE score.Type: ApplicationFiled: May 17, 2016Publication date: November 24, 2016Applicant: Devicescape Software, Inc.Inventors: Simon Wynn, John Gordon
